    IPL 2023 | LSG vs GT: Tom Moody defends KL Rahul’s strike rate, says criticism is excessive

    Former Australian cricketer, Tom Moody, has weighed in on the debate surrounding the strike rate of Lucknow Super Giants (LSG) skipper, KL Rahul, in IPL 2023. Moody believes that Rahul is often unfairly criticized for his slow strike rate, and that he played a great knock in the recent game against Rajasthan Royals.

    Despite winning the match against Rajasthan Royals by 10 runs, LSG’s batting performance was lackluster. However, their bowlers put on an impressive display to defend their total of 154 runs. Despite the win, much of the focus was on Rahul’s strike rate, which has been a topic of concern for some time.

    In six games so far, Rahul has scored 174 runs with an average of 32.33. However, he has been criticized for his strike rate of just 114.79, which many feel is too slow. Moody, however, thinks that the criticism is overblown and that Rahul played a great knock against Rajasthan Royals.

    Speaking to ESPNCricinfo, Moody said that Rahul assessed the conditions well and made the right decisions as captain. Moody was also impressed with Marcus Stoinis’ bowling, as the all-rounder picked up two crucial wickets and conceded only 28 runs in his first bowling spell of the tournament.

    Moody praised Stoinis for his ability to bowl dead straight, which he said was critical on a surface that offered a little bit of inconsistency with its pace and bounce.

    LSG’s next match will be against the Gujarat Titans on Saturday, 22nd April. While Rahul’s strike rate will likely remain a topic of discussion, Moody’s comments suggest that he believes the batter is being unfairly criticized. It remains to be seen whether Rahul can maintain his form and prove his critics wrong in the upcoming matches.
